## Account Recovery During Queue Migration

While we replace the legacy Hobnail job queue with Ferriwheel, account-recovery jobs are dual-written to both systems. If a user's recovery email never arrives, check the Ferriwheel dead-letter shelf first; Hobnail's retry daemon is already disabled. Requeue from the shelf using the standard replay script, then confirm delivery in the audit trail. If Ferriwheel itself is unreachable, you must restart its coordinator from the warm standby in the Dunmore rack, which will ask for the phrase below.

vault phrase of yagag-kadup = belael-druius-rusax-kelox

# Verdantly Controller — Environments

Sensor drift is the top pager cause in prod greenhouses. Humidity probes drift ~2% per week; the controller compensates via nightly recalibration against the reference probe in Bay 3. Staging uses simulated sensors, so drift alerts there are noise — silence them. If prod drift exceeds threshold mid-cycle, the controller falls back to last-known-good offsets rather than raw readings. Recalibration and threshold behavior are governed by the configuration below.

service settings:
ulaael:
  log_level: warn
  metrics_host: metrics.ulaael.tolvaqsys.internal
  pin: 7801
  pool_size: 16

Moving the nightly crons off the Dapplewood box onto the Ferrowire workflow engine: don't panic if you see duplicate job names this week, both schedulers run in shadow mode until Friday. Only Ferrowire actually writes results; the cron side logs and exits. If a nightly job misses its window, check the Ferrowire queue depth first before touching cron — reviving the old path will cause double writes. Escalate only if the queue is stuck over an hour. The migration cutover build is recorded right below.

trace token, fafog-kageg: htk4_98e6